Ebay auction for iPhone prototype hits $25K overnight

Wednesday, August 29, 2018 by Piyush Suthar | Comments

Home News Tech Ebay auction for iPhone prototype hits $25K overnight

A seller on eBay claims to be offering a piece of Apple history — a functional iPhone prototype circa 2006. Over 100 bids have been logged on the listing, and the price is now reaching into the high five figures. The seller, one “321dady,” calls the device the “rarest of them all.” The etching on the back proclaims it to be Version 1.1.1, and according to 321dady, it was made in 2006 in Cupertino.
